MultiFixRadSoft: A Comprehensive Tool for Primary Relative Radiometric Scale Realization in Radiation Thermometry
Mehtap Ertürk1,2, Mevlüt Karabulut2, Ömer Faruk Kadı1
1National Metrology Institute, The Scientific and Technological Research Council of Türkiye (TÜBİTAK-UME, Ulusal Metroloji Enstitüsü), Gebze 41470, Türkiye.
This study introduces MultiFixRadSoft, an open-source software for thermodynamic temperature scale realization using relative primary radiation thermometry (RPRT). The software ensures accurate temperature measurements and uncertainty evaluation according to the new kelvin definition.
Area of Science:
- Metrology and Scientific Instrumentation
- Thermodynamics and Temperature Measurement
Background:
- The new definition of the kelvin requires robust methods for thermodynamic temperature scale realization and uncertainty evaluation.
- Existing methods for radiation thermometry can be complex, necessitating accessible and accurate software solutions.
Purpose of the Study:
- To present a practical implementation of relative primary radiation thermometry (RPRT).
- To introduce MultiFixRadSoft, an open-source software package for thermodynamic temperature scale realization and uncertainty evaluation.
- To validate the software's performance using established fixed points and a linear radiation thermometer.
Main Methods:
- Development of MultiFixRadSoft, an open-source software adhering to the Mise-en-Pratique for the kelvin (MeP-K).
- Utilized ITS-90 metal fixed points and high-temperature fixed points (HTFPs) for scale realization.
- Incorporated automated routines for melting plateau analysis, correction modules (emissivity, nonlinearity, etc.), and Sakuma-Hattori fitting.
Main Results:
- Experimental validation using six fixed points (Cu, Fe-C, Co-C, Pd-C, Ru-C, WC-C) demonstrated software accuracy.
- The software successfully performed ITS-90 extrapolation and flexible calibration schemes (n=1 to n>=3).
- Results showed excellent agreement with manual analyses and published data, confirming algorithm correctness.
Conclusions:
- MultiFixRadSoft provides a unified, transparent framework for data processing, scale realization, and uncertainty analysis in radiometric thermometry.
- The software is a robust and accessible tool for emerging NMIs and industrial laboratories.
- Promotes wider adoption of primary thermodynamic temperature realization methods.
